In the universal set U={1,2,3,4,5,6,7,8,9}, let A={2,4,6,8} and B={1,2,3,4}. If all complements are taken with respect to U, what is (Aᶜ∪B)ᶜ?

Answer and explanation

Correct answer: {6,8}

The complement of A with respect to U is Aᶜ={1,3,5,7,9}. Therefore, Aᶜ∪B={1,2,3,4,5,7,9}. The elements of U not in this union are 6 and 8, so (Aᶜ∪B)ᶜ={6,8}. The same result follows directly from De Morgan’s law: (Aᶜ∪B)ᶜ=A∩Bᶜ. Since Bᶜ={5,6,7,8,9}, the intersection with A is {6,8}.
